ALL
ODI
T20
Test
100B
T10

CWC League B 2024-26
Nov 6 - Jan 30Played for ITA

Italy-Rome T10 2024
Aug 12 - Aug 23Played for CPNL

T20 World Cup Europe QLF A 2024
Jun 9 - Jun 16Played for ITA

Challenge League Play-off 2024
Feb 22 - Mar 3Played for ITA

WC EUR Qualifier 2023
Jul 20 - Jul 28Played for ITA

CWC League B 2024-26
Nov 6 - Jan 30Played for ITA
ODI
108
Runs
7
Inns
21.60
Average
99.08
Strike rate